Rifugio Furio Bianchet
5.0About
The CAI manages 52 beds across multiple rooms, plus 6 emergency places. Hot showers are available. The kitchen serves dinner and breakfast during the staffed season (summer months); in winter the hut remains open but unstaffed, so bring your own food. Drinking water runs from the tap. There is no WiFi. The hut works well for families tackling the Alta Via in stages, and mountain bikers use it as a waypoint on valley-to-ridge routes.
Book directly by email or phone—contact details are listed on rifugi.cai.it. For July and August, book at least 6–8 weeks ahead. Outside peak season, 2–3 weeks' notice usually suffices. Confirm the staffed dates before booking winter stays, as limited services apply.
